121 SNS: Psalm 53: Who Is the One Who Says, "There Is No God?"

To help you hear the prayerfulness of the Psalms, here is a Monday Morning Psalm just for you.

Can I just say, that this psalm seems to have many layers to it? Specifically speaking, the phrase, “Those who say, there is no God,” can apply to 2 different sets of folks. The first is a straightforward application. Those who say there is no God are the people who simply want nothing to do with God. The second one is found just under the surface and it is, if possible, an even more tragic one. What if the irreligious unbeliever spoken of, is one we consider to be very religious? One who goes to church and says that they are a Christian. Give a listen and let me know what you think.
